I just tried to swap out my standard receiver in my bedroom with a HD one. I really didn't want to pay the $99 fee but decided to anyway. I spent 1 hour on the phone and the lady tells me there is a $50 fee that she can't waive. She transfer me to another guy and he tells me the same thing. "Because I am a new customer". Anyone ever hear of this? I tried telling them I could buy at Best Buy for $99 without that fee. He said that when I went to activate it - the charge would be added to my account.

I think that fee only applies during your first 6 months of service. Call back after you have been with D* for 6 months and you won't have to pay the fee. I think it has something to do with offsetting the cost of the second install for about the same contract lenght.
 
I just got off the phone with another CSR. She/he told me it was a Processing Fee that can't be waived. The interesting thing is she/he told me to go to Circuit City/Best Buy and buy a receiver for same cost. Go home and swap the boxes. No fee. Odd. I would hate to get the other receiver home and when I go to activate it - get charged $50.
